Marie M. Loftus, 75, of Albuquerque, died Sunday, Aug. 8, 2004.

She was born on Feb. 17, 1929, in Clovis, to Ray and Ethel Miller.

She married Martin Loftus. She moved to Albuquerque in 1982. She was employed by Presbyterian Hospital as a radiology transcription and manager of medical records, retiring in 1999. She was stricken with polio in 1943 and breast cancer in 1976. Family members said she will be remembered as a generous, courageous, gentle, fun, optimistic and steadfast woman and a woman of sophisticated taste, particularly for art, antiques and fashionable shoes.

Survivors include her children, Dr. Theresa Hodin (and husband, Dr. Mark) of Buffalo, N.Y., Michael Loftus (Jeanne) of Albuquerque and Michelle Collins (Paul) of Montana; five grandchildren, Riley Hodin, Shane and Tarah Foxx and Ian and Ben Collins; two sisters, Maxine Koscielski (Carl) and Patricia Greathouse (Larry); a brother, Charles, and his family of Colorado; and many nieces, nephews and cousins.
